Redis提升数据处理速度的利器(为什么redis会快很多)

2023-05-04 07:16:03 数据处理 提升 利器

Redis(Remote Dictionary Server)是Linux平台上最流行的开源内存数据库,它通过将数据储存在内存中,极大地提升了数据处理速度。

Redis拥有丰富的数据结构,包括字符串,列表,散列,集合等,可以用于缓存,会话管理,任务队列,消息队列等多种用途。它的特点是支持数据持久化,可以将内存中的数据保存到硬盘,以及能够处理高并发读写请求,成为数据持久化和高并发的基础。

使用Redis的极大优势是,它可以极大地提升数据处理速度,约比传统数据库快100倍,因此Redis可以大大提高应用程序的执行效率,对缓存系统尤为重要。另外,Redis还支持使用Lua脚本来执行批量操作,实现快速更新,以减少网络延迟。

使用Redis的基本步骤包括安装、配置、部署和使用。下载Redis并将其安装在操作系统上。然后,编辑Redis.conf文件,进行必要的配置设置,比如监听端口号、数据库大小等。将Redis服务部署在多台服务器上,实现可用性和扩容,用于读写操作。使用Redis时,可以利用Redis客户端程序,如Redis-cli,通过shell环境与Redis服务器进行交互,以完成相关数据操作,比如set、get、incr等。

例如,下面的代码用于设置哈希表key的值:

hset key field1 value1

以上就是关于Redis的简介。作为一种内存数据库,Redis的特点是支持高并发,支持数据持久化,可以极大提升数据处理速度,有效地提升应用程序的执行效率。基于Redis的高性能,已经成为各类应用的首选。

相关文章